Not sure to understand but merging MADV_REMOVE into MADV_FREE apparently would break freebsd apps that might expect a noop instead. And it could break Solaris apps if they execpt a -EINVAL (though the latter is more dubious, but I doubt making differences is worth it and if freebsd makes it a noop I'd stick with the noop and leave MADV_REMOVE alone). > are the Solaris ones. Don't know past behaviour about "breaking existing to > comply to standards" (new syscall slot?). The change I suggested would be backwards compatible because it can only affect performance. The only thing that can break right now, is running a non-linux (and apparently posix too) app on a linux system that will corrupt memory with potential data loss. > Provide our fine-grained semantics with new, not misunderstandable identifiers > (MADV_FREE_DISCARD, MADV_FREE_CACHE, for instance). Why should we deviate for the sake of porting pain, when we can comply at no tangible risk for us? > Making their apps work by causing the same breakage to Linux apps is a better > idea? Again: if an app breaks it means it's working by pure luck because it's depending on fragile timings in the first place. Call it a potential lower performance or less efficient memory utilization, a breakage not.
